Yellow Fever is a studio album by Nigerian musician Fela Kuti, originally released in 1976 via Barclay Records.

The title track, “Yellow Fever”, is a scathing criticism of post-colonial Nigerians who cannot shake their “colonial mentality.” The second track of the album is the notorious “Na Poi” (loosely translating to “things collide”) which was banned by the Nigerian Broadcasting Company for its explicit sexual references.
